Šariš Castle was a medieval power center of Šariš region. Its ruins are situated on a hill above the town of Veľký Šariš, northwest of Prešov. Archaeological research proved the settlement of the castle hill in Neolithic, late Stone Age and in the Bronze Age (13th - 11th century BC).
The construction of the stone castle began in the 13th century. During the centuries, the castle changed owners until a store of gunpowder exploded in the castle in 1660 and damaged the castle considerably. Later on, they used it only for troop accommodation. In 1687, the castle burned down and was not restored again.
Today, the castle is a popular place for walks of the inhabitants of Prešov and its surroundings. There is a marked, approximately 2 km long hiking trail leading from Veľký Šariš and Šarisské Michaľany and it is also possible to get on a bike here. The access road also serves as an educational trail. The entire castle hill is the National Nature Reserve.
